Debate over Buncombe’s Craggy Dam. Value, cost, benefit and future in doubt.

How do you put a price on a 122-year-old mass of concrete sitting in the middle of a river? The value of Craggy Dam on the French Broad River in Buncombe County is now at the center of a debate over river restoration, flood mitigation, power generation and the future of aging dams across the region.

Built in 1904, the dam in Woodfin supplies a portion of the energy used by its owner, the Buncombe County Metropolitan Sewerage District, to power a portion of its wastewater treatment facility.

In 2022 a group of environmental organizations known as the Craggy Coalition approached the MSD to discuss the removal of the dam, which is 13-foot-high and nearly two football fields long…
